use crate::base::*;
impl TwoFloat {
pub fn abs(&self) -> TwoFloat {
if self.hi > 0.0
|| (self.hi == 0.0 && self.hi.is_sign_positive() && self.lo.is_sign_positive())
{
self.clone()
} else {
-self
}
}
pub fn is_sign_positive(&self) -> bool {
self.hi > 0.0 || (self.hi == 0.0 && self.hi.is_sign_positive())
}
pub fn is_sign_negative(&self) -> bool {
self.hi < 0.0 || (self.hi == 0.0 && self.hi.is_sign_negative())
}
}
#[cfg(test)]
mod tests {
use super::*;
#[test]
fn abs_test() {
assert_eq!(
TwoFloat { hi: 0.0, lo: 0.0 }.abs(),
TwoFloat { hi: 0.0, lo: 0.0 }
);
assert!(TwoFloat { hi: 0.0, lo: -0.0 }.abs().lo.is_sign_positive());
assert!(TwoFloat { hi: -0.0, lo: 0.0 }.abs().lo.is_sign_negative());
}
#[test]
fn is_sign_positive_test() {
assert!(TwoFloat { hi: 0.0, lo: -0.0 }.is_sign_positive());
assert!(!TwoFloat { hi: -0.0, lo: 0.0 }.is_sign_positive());
assert!(!TwoFloat { hi: -0.0, lo: -0.0 }.is_sign_positive());
assert!(TwoFloat {
hi: 1.0,
lo: -1e-300
}
.is_sign_positive());
assert!(!TwoFloat {
hi: -1.0,
lo: -1e-300
}
.is_sign_positive());
}
#[test]
fn is_sign_negative_test() {
assert!(!TwoFloat { hi: 0.0, lo: -0.0 }.is_sign_negative());
assert!(TwoFloat { hi: -0.0, lo: 0.0 }.is_sign_negative());
assert!(TwoFloat { hi: -0.0, lo: -0.0 }.is_sign_negative());
assert!(!TwoFloat {
hi: 1.0,
lo: -1e-300
}
.is_sign_negative());
assert!(TwoFloat {
hi: -1.0,
lo: -1e-300
}
.is_sign_negative());
}
}
